How Responsibility Shifts After Crashes
Evidence, police reports, and weight of fault steer claims. Companies may fight payouts, while insurers negotiate settlements. Studies indicate clear signage and training reduce repeat incidents. Victims commonly recover costs via third‑party claims.

Quick Q&A
Q: Can a driver be personally liable for a crash?
A: Yes, if reckless behavior or rule violations are proven. Company records and dashcam footage often decide this.
Q: What helps a victim secure fair compensation?
A: Gather photos, witness contacts, and medical records early. Legal guidance helps navigate insurer tactics and deadlines.
